Patent examiners are skilled engineers and scientists who work closely with entrepreneurs to process their patent applications and determine whether a patent can be granted. Learn more about becoming a patent examiner.
Trademark examining attorneys analyze trademark applications, evaluate facts, and then determine questions of law that ultimately can lead to federal trademark registration. Learn more about joining the Trademarks legal team.
